What kinds of apartments do you have?

The Boxley has 24 apartment suites with secured building access, featuring 6 different floor plans. All suites have granite countertops, stainless steel appliances (dishwasher, refrigerator, oven and microwave), garbage disposals, and efficiency size washer/dryer.

What is the utility fee?

Each apartment suite is billed a $85 Utility Fee each month, which reflects a substantial discount on utilities for residents. The fee includes the following:

  • Water, sewer, trash
  • High speed internet access
  • Limited-access building with digital surveillance system
  • Package delivery services

Cable and electric are not included in the utility fee. Residents establish service directly with AEP.

When is rent due?

Rent is due the first day of each calendar month. Pay rent online and request maintenance here.

What is the pet policy?

The Boxley does not allow pets.

What is the term of the lease?

Leases terms are for one year.

What about parking?

Residents of The Boxley may participate in the City of Roanoke’s Residential Parking Program.

HISTORY

The Boxley Building was built in 1921-22 by builder-developer-quarry owner William Wise Boxley, who was also mayor of Roanoke when the building first opened. The building stands eight stories high with granite on the first story. Read More
